4 out of 5 stars Album lives up to its title   June 5, 2008
 13 out of 14 found this review helpful

This latest edition in the Now series features a few familiar names as well as many newcomers such as Leona Lewis, John Mayer, Flyleaf, and Metro Station among others. For the casual listener, this is a great sampler of today's music. Listed below are the songs' peak postion on the Billboard Hot 100 unless otherwise noted.

Bleeding Love-#1
Break The Ice-#43
Killa-#39
Lollipop-#1 (this week)
Sexy Can I?-#3
With You-#2
Te Quiero-#90/#1 Latin
Pocketful Of Sunshine-#8
No Air-#3
Realize-#20
Stop And Stare-#12
Say-#12
All Around Me-#43
Shake It-#29
Beat It-#19
Whatever It Takes-#33
Feels Like Tonight-#24/#1 Adult Top 40
In Love With A Girl-#24
You're Gonna Miss This-#12
Our Song-#16

TT 72:41
